Someone please help. I have a 98 silverado with a third door. The bottom of the third door has a hole about 1/2 inch tall and 6-8 inches long in it just above the door crease. What s the best way to fix this? Pick out the bad rust, sand the metal, fill with bondo, sand and then paint? DON'T just fill it with bondo, unless you want it to fall apart in a couple years. Bondo is meant to smooth out surfaces, not fill holes.

 

To do it right, you'd need to cut out all the bad metal, (which is likely a lot more than it looks like, it's like how you can only see just the tip of the iceberg, most of it is hidden) and weld in a patch panel.

 

I'd suggest taking it to a body shop and seeing what they say, it may be cheaper to replace the whole door. :dunno:

In the old days, body men would grind out the rusted area and fill it in with lead. That was before my time but it was the best rust repair other than cutting out and patching the metal... which is the only real fix.
